Some more question about morale check ...
 
As far as I know about morale is:

Quote:



A unit is called to make a "morale check" when wounded, when a squad member dies, when hit by fear inducing weapons, spells and fear auras, when repelled (but this will not induce mrlloss IIRC). Perhaps when other squads rout. Not sure about that one.

When a units is called to make a "morale check" most often it means: 2d6 + mrl - mrlloss) vs (2d6 + 10) IIRC

A squad start to rout when the sum of the mrl loss is higher then the squad size (or something like that) and fails a squad mrl check (average mrl of squad members + some kind of bonus for squad size).

Standards reduces mrl losses in an area equal to the standard effect by one each turn. Leadership has no effect on morale.

Sermon of Courage and Fanaticism both reset the morale status to the default level of any unit that has suffered a failure on its morale check.

[Kristoffer O. and Graeme Dice]

2) What 'Frighten' does ?
3) What 'Panic' does ?
4) What 'Terror' does ?

<font size="2" face="sans-serif, arial, verdana">All cause a morale check. The morale loss from Panic is lesser but Panic covers a larger area.

All cause a morale check. The morale loss from Panic is lesser but Panic covers a larger area.
<font size="2" face="sans-serif, arial, verdana">I believe that the morale loss is the same between Panic and Terror, but that the morale check is harder for terror than panic. Panic is made at -3, while terror is made at -5 if I remember correctly.
